Olympiacos – Panathinaikos: The days and referees of the semi-finals of the Challenge Cup

All the details of the matches between Olympiakos and Panathinaikos for the semifinals of the Challenge Cup in men’s volleyball have become known. Ticket sales for the first game have started.

The countdown to the eternal duels between Olympiacos and Panathinaikos in the semi-finals of the Challenge Cup is running into the final phase.

As has become known, the two games will take place in “Melina Merkouri” and in the hall of Amarousiou. THE The first game will take place on Tuesday (7th February) at 8 p.m. and the second semi-final in Agios Thomas on Wednesday (15th February) at 7 p.m.

The referees, who will be Greeks, have also been announced. Something similar happened in the past when we had Italian teams civil war.

In the first semi-final, the first referee will be Alexandros Nikolakis, followed by Nikos Fragakis, while in the second semi-final, the first referee will be Nontas Gerothodoros and the second will be Alexandros Avramidis.

We remind you that on Wednesday (02/01) the sale of tickets for the first game started.

The corresponding announcement in detail: “OLYMPIAKOS SFP, for the first semi-final of the CEV Challenge Cup in the hall of Rentis “M. Merkouris” (Tuesday 2/7, 20:00), vs Panathinaikos, informs its fans and members of the following:

Ticket sales will start on Wednesday (February 1st) at 10:00 a.m. and will take place in the Members/Fans Department office in the “G. Karaiskakis” (under door 19-Emporiki Stoa) daily and 10:00-18:00.

Ticket prices are as follows: €10 (middle stand), €20 (VIP), €30 seats (second row), €50 seats (first row).

*The membership card is not valid in the first semi-final of the CEV Challenge Cup in the Rentishalle, only the volleyball season tickets.

A doctor from the Yenisei volleyball club provided emergency assistance to a child on board the plane

The doctor of the men’s volleyball club “Yenisei” from Krasnoyarsk, Shakhriyar Mirzoev, provided emergency assistance to the boy on board the plane.

The incident happened during the New Year holidays on the Kazan-Krasnoyarsk flight. The specialist noticed that the man and child were in the toilet for 20 minutes, and the flight attendant came in there periodically.

“I approached and saw that a boy of about nine was standing at the sink filled with water and blood. At that moment, the flight attendant began to ask if there was a doctor on board, to which I replied: “I’m a doctor, I’ll help now.”

I tried to stop the bleeding using cotton wool and improvised means that the conductors had, applying cold to the bridge of the nose. But this had no effect – everything was soaked in blood. The bleeding did not stop for about 20 minutes.

I tried to calm the child down and began to think about what to do next. I asked the flight attendants for a first aid kit and found ampoules of adrenaline there. Having opened two ampoules, I soaked two cotton pads with the solution and inserted them deep into the child’s nose. After a couple of minutes, I saw that the blood had stopped,” AiF Krasnoyarsk quotes Mirzoev as saying.

The child came to his senses. As it turned out, the boy had undergone surgery to remove his adenoids the day before, which probably caused the bleeding.

Lokomotiv volleyball players beat MSTU in a Russian championship match

Novosibirsk Lokomotiv defeated Moscow MSTU in the match of the 18th round of the Russian Volleyball Championship.

The meeting in Moscow ended with a score of 3–2 (25:21, 20:25, 25:23, 23:25, 15:10) in favor of the guests.

Lokomotiv scored 44 points and ranks second in the Super League standings, MSTU (6 points) is 16th.

In other matches of the day, the Gazprom-Ugra club beat Dynamo-Ural from Ufa at home (3–0, 26:24, 28:26, 25:21), Nizhny Novgorod Gorky lost away to Orenburg (0–3, 28:30, 11:25, 25:27), Belogorye took victory over Yaroslavich in Tula (3–0, 25:17, 25:15, 25:22).

In the Women’s Super League, Minsk in the away match of the 17th round defeated the Zarechye-Odintsovo team with a score of 3-2 (15:25, 22:25, 25:21, 25:15, 15:7).

Volleyball players of St. Petersburg “Zenith” beat “Nova” and won their fifth victory in a row in the Super League

St. Petersburg “Zenith” defeated “Nova” from Novokuybyshevsk in the match of the 18th round of the Russian Volleyball Championship.

The meeting in St. Petersburg ended with a score of 3–2 (25:17, 25:21, 19:25, 20:25, 15:13). Zenit extended its winning streak in the Super League to five matches.

In other matches of the day, Zenit Kazan beat Krasnoyarsk Yenisey at home – 3-1 (25:18, 25:20, 25:27, 25:20), the Dynamo-LO club (Sosnovy Bor) defeated Kemerovo Kuzbass at home – 3-0 (25:15, 25:19, 25:20).

The leader in the table is Zenit Kazan (16 wins, 45 points), Zenit from St. Petersburg (14 wins, 43 points) is second.
